Special Education (Pre-K to 12) Major Develop impactful instructional strategies for working with students who have mild to severe disabilities with the Bachelor of Science in Education in Special Education (Pre-K to 12) in Temple University’s College of Education and Human Development. This 123-credit undergraduate degree emphasizes effective special education teaching skills and effective ...

The budget includes a blended 4.2% increase for 2024–2025 undergraduate and graduate tuition for both in-state and out-of-state students, and it is applicable across all the university’s academic programs.

by Dr. Molefi Kete Asante Martin Delany lived during an extraordinary time in the history of African people. Among his contemporaries in the struggle for genuine African liberation were James McCune Smith, a physician and professor; James W. C. Pennington, orator and minister; Alexander Crummell, philosopher and minister; Frederick Douglass, abolitionist and orator; and William Wells Brown ...

The Application Security Verification Standard is built upon the shoulders of those involved from ASVS 1.0 in 2008 to 3.0 in 2016. Much of the structure and verification items that are still in the ASVS today were originally written by Mike Boberski, Jeff Williams and Dave Wichers, but there are many more contributors. Since Judge Alan Albright took the bench in the Western District of Texas in 2018, his docket has become the new hotspot for patent litigation. The authors identify five reasons why the Western District is attractive to patentees and explain why they are problematic.
